Warning Signs You Need Document Drying Services
Don't ignore these warning signs, as they can show serious damage to your documents. If you notice any of the following, it's time to call our team:
Musty Odors That Won't Go Away
A musty smell can be a sign of mold or mildew growth on your documents. If left unchecked, this can lead to permanent damage and loss of valuable information.
Warped or Buckled Pages
Warped or buckled pages can show excessive moisture or water damage. If not addressed quickly, this can lead to further damage and make it difficult to restore your documents.
Visible Water Stains or Damage
Visible water stains or damage can be a clear indication of water damage. If you notice any of these signs, it's ess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Document Discoloration or Fading
Document discoloration or fading can be a sign of exposure to water or humidity. If left unchecked, this can lead to permanent damage and loss of valuable information.
